HANDOVER — Voss to Ardelin. Branch managers: Kelsmoor plant runs at 92% through Q2; no new shift approvals until the Bramwick line audit closes. Defer tooling orders for the Ventrix series. If Harfield volumes spike, route overflow to Dunlath, not overtime. Ardelin takes sign-off authority from Monday. Escalate only genuine stoppages. Budget holds flat; no exceptions without my counter-signature this week. Full rationale for the capacity freeze is set out in the note below.

internal memo for kawip-hadug: Headcount on the Wenwyn team goes from 7 to 140 by the end of January. Gross margin on Wenwyn came in at 20 percent against a plan of 15 percent.

### Step 4: Sign your snapshot bundle

Before PixelProof will accept your plugin's UI snapshot tests, the bundle needs a signature. Run `pixelproof bundle --snapshots` from your plugin root, then sign the output. Don't worry if the first run regenerates a bunch of baselines — that's normal. Once signing succeeds, upload via the partner portal. Use the plugin deploy key shown here:

release key, fajef-kajeg: bky19_LdLu6Ne6FLi8he2c24d

Runbook: Twigreaper, our stale-branch cleanup bot. It scans repos nightly and deletes merged branches older than the cutoff — protected branches and anything tagged keep-alive are skipped. If someone yells about a deleted branch, reflog recovery works for 30 days. Before touching anything, check the bot's live configuration values below.

config for kafof-bawef:
holath:
  log_level: debug
  metrics_host: metrics.holath.qorvelsys.internal
  pin: 2191
  pool_size: 32

## Step 4: Close out the descriptor leak

Greywick 3.2 tightened descriptor accounting after the long leak hunt in the plugin host. Plugins must now release handles explicitly; the host no longer reaps them on unload. Run the audit mode once against your plugin before publishing. The audit mode expects the following configuration values:

service settings:
[casax]
port = 6379
team = rusir
host = casax.zemvarhq.corp
region = outer-4
access_code = ac_9808ce
timeout_ms = 1500